Russian Writer Survives Assassination Attempt, Suspect Charged with Terrorism.

TL;DR Summary
Writer and politician Zakhar Prilepin survived an assassination attempt in the Nizhny Novgorod region when his car exploded, killing his driver and bodyguard. Prilepin suffered injuries, including two broken legs, and was airlifted to a hospital where he underwent surgery. He confirmed that he had dropped his daughter off five minutes before the explosion. A suspect, Alexander Permyakov, was arrested by Russia's Internal Affairs Ministry, which claims Ukrainian intelligence services and the West are responsible for the attack.
